4 min read | By Muhammed Irbaz | 02 July 2026 | Artificial Intelligence
Choosing the right AI development company comes down to checking technical expertise, industry experience, pricing transparency, and post-launch support, not just polished portfolios. The best approach is to run every shortlisted vendor through a structured checklist covering scalability, data security, and team composition, then validate the strongest candidates with a short pilot project before committing to a larger engagement.
1. Picking the right AI development company isn’t about who pitches best, it comes down to real expertise, honest pricing, and a track record that holds up under scrutiny.
2. A simple checklist covering security, scalability, and communication beats relying on gut feeling when comparing vendors.
3. Costs vary a lot depending on the engagement fixed-price for smaller projects, dedicated teams for ongoing work.
4. The best partners stick around after launch instead of disappearing once the invoice is paid.
Source: Grandviewresearch
An AI development company builds AI systems for businesses, chatbots, recommendation engines, fraud detection tools, and automation workflows ranging from small teams to large firms with hundreds of engineers.
What sets them apart from regular AI software development company vendors is the skill set involved. Beyond developers, they need people who understand data and how models learn, and most AI software development companies spend significant time cleaning and structuring data before training begins.
Many also act as AI consulting companies, first assessing whether AI is even the right solution before writing any code and a credible vendor will say so honestly, even when the answer is no.
The right AI development company is chosen by evaluating technical expertise, domain experience, security practices, and pricing transparency side by side, then confirming the fit with a small pilot project.
Selecting the right AI development partner determines how reliable, scalable, and cost-effective the final solution will be. With many agencies now claiming AI expertise, businesses need a clear way to separate genuine capability from marketing language.
| Factor | What to Look For |
|---|---|
| Technical expertise | Proven experience in relevant AI areas (ML, NLP, computer vision, or generative AI) and modern frameworks |
| Domain experience | Prior work in the client’s industry, given differing data and compliance needs |
| Portfolio | Verifiable past projects with measurable results, not vague claims |
| Data & security practices | Clear protocols for data privacy and regulatory compliance |
| Team composition | A mix of data scientists, ML engineers, and domain experts |
| Post-deployment support | A plan for monitoring, maintenance, and retraining after launch |
| Pricing transparency | Clear costs covering development, data prep, and iteration |
Most failed AI engagements don’t fail because of bad models, they fail because of bad data handoffs. A vendor’s first two weeks on a pilot project, specifically how they handle your existing data mess, predicts the outcome of the entire engagement far better than any case study can.
A reliable evaluation checklist covers technical expertise, industry experience, communication, scalability, security standards, post-launch support, and pricing transparency.
It helps to put everything on paper instead of relying on gut feeling alone. Here’s a rough checklist worth running through with every vendor you talk to:
| Evaluation Criteria | What to Check |
|---|---|
| Technical Expertise | Real hands-on experience in machine learning development, NLP, or computer vision not just buzzwords on a website |
| Industry Experience | Have they actually worked in your sector before finance, healthcare, retail, whatever applies |
| Communication | One point of contact, regular updates, no disappearing for two weeks mid-project |
| Scalability | Built on cloud-native, modular architecture so it grows with you |
| Security Standards | Encryption, compliance certifications, proper access controls |
| Post-Launch Support | Will they still answer your calls after the launch, or is that it |
| Pricing Transparency | A cost breakdown you can actually understand, no surprise invoices later |
When you’re comparing several leading AI development companies side by side, this kind of table makes it much easier to spot which one is all talk and which one actually has substance behind the pitch.
Businesses should verify client references, data ownership terms, the actual team composition, integration support, and change-management capability before signing any contract.
Before signing anything, it’s worth digging a bit deeper than the sales call:
1. Ask for client references and actually call them. Case studies on a website tell you what the company wants you to know.
2. Find out who owns the trained models and data once the project wraps up. This gets messy if it’s not in writing upfront.
3. Check who’s actually building your product. Is it the senior team you spoke to, or will the work get handed off to juniors?
4. Make sure they can handle AI consulting services with whatever systems you already have: CRMs, ERPs, old legacy software, all of it.
5. Ask how they handle the human side of things. Good business automation rollouts usually fail or succeed based on how well the internal team is trained, not the tech itself.
This matters even more for enterprise AI development companies, where one new system has to fit into a much bigger, messier web of existing departments and tools.
AI development pricing typically follows one of four models: fixed price, time and material, dedicated team, or outcome-based, depending on project scope and engagement length.
Honestly, there’s no single number anyone can give you here; pricing for AI development services swings a lot depending on the complexity of what you’re building, where the team is based, and how the engagement is structured. Most vendors stick to one of these models:
| Pricing Model | Best For |
|---|---|
| Fixed Price | Smaller, clearly scoped projects |
| Time & Material | Projects that evolve or involve a lot of research |
| Dedicated Team | Ongoing, long-term development work |
| Outcome-Based | Engagements tied to specific performance goals |
A lot of businesses dip their toes in with time-and-material pricing first, just to see how a vendor performs, before committing to a full dedicated team a common approach when exploring AI outsourcing for the first time. Costs climb noticeably once you get into generative AI development, mainly because of the compute power and the sheer volume of data these projects need.
Top AI development companies are best compared by specialization, startup versus enterprise readiness, innovation track record, and the strength of their post-launch support system.
Comparing top AI agent development companies against the bigger, more general-purpose vendors isn’t really about who has the flashier website. A few practical angles to think about:
● A firm that specializes purely in AI agent development will usually outperform a generalist on complex, agent-driven workflows. But if your needs span multiple use cases, broader custom AI development companies might give you more room to maneuver.
● Some vendors are built for speed and flexibility, ideal for AI development companies for startups working with tighter budgets and faster turnarounds. Others are set up specifically for top AI development companies for enterprises, where compliance and red tape slow everything down
● Pay attention to who’s actually publishing research or contributing to open-source work; that’s usually a decent signal of depth among the best generative AI development companies, beyond just marketing copy.
● A strong support system matters more than people expect. The better enterprise AI solutions providers keep dedicated teams around well after launch, especially for businesses mid-way through a larger digital transformation push.
At the end of the day, there’s no universal “best” company. It comes down to your budget, your timeline, and how ready your team actually is to work with AI day-to-day.
Finding the right fit among the best AI development companies isn’t about picking whoever has the most polished portfolio or the lowest quote. It comes down to actually checking their technical depth, being upfront about pricing, making sure the system can scale, and confirming they’ll be around for support later. Whether the goal is custom AI development, rolling out AI automation solutions, or just getting advice from one of the leading AI consulting firms out there, the right partner should feel less like a vendor and more like someone genuinely invested in the outcome. Run through the checklist above with every company on your shortlist, and the decision gets a lot less overwhelming.
The best companies vary by use case, but strong ones share proven AI project portfolio, clear pricing, and real industry experience. There’s no universal winner, only the right fit for a specific business.
Evaluate vendors on domain expertise, communication, scalability, and security practices. A structured checklist works better than judging on a sales pitch alone.
Enterprises should look for vendors experienced in complex integrations, compliance, and large-scale data handling. Firms offering dedicated, long-term support tend to suit enterprise needs best.
Pricing depends on the engagement model, with fixed-scope, hourly, and dedicated-team options each suited to different project needs. Costs vary based on complexity, team seniority, and how clearly the project requirements are defined upfront.
Services typically include AI consulting, custom development, system integration, and automation. Many also provide ongoing model fine-tuning and post-launch support.
A development company builds and deploys AI systems, while a consulting firm focuses on strategy. Many vendors today handle both roles together.
Join over 150,000+ subscribers who get our best digital insights, strategies and tips delivered straight to their inbox.